The bright side is that many minor dings and damages can be dealt with by mobile wise repairs (likewise known as paint-less damage Visit website removal). Small damages to the body work can typically be eliminated without the requirement to repaint the panel and is an extremely cost-effective method of fixing damages, typically costing around ₤ 60 per damage/ panel. If the paint is harmed however and needs painting, it's most likely to set you back a whole lot even more and not likely to be something you wish to organize whilst you have the vehicle on hire.
